Beyond the Surface: What Adaptive Equipment Really Does

Adaptive equipment isn’t one-size-fits-all. It spans tactile tools, sensory regulation devices, and digital interfaces—each engineered to align with how a student’s brain processes information. For a student with dyslexia, for example, text-to-speech software with synchronized highlighting doesn’t just read aloud; it reinforces phonemic awareness through visual and auditory reinforcement. In controlled trials, this multimodal approach increases reading fluency by up to 37% over three months—evidence that the right tool doesn’t just aid learning, it transforms it.

But equipment alone isn’t magic. A 2022 study from the University of Melbourne tracked 120 students using weighted lap pads and fidget tools during executive function tasks. While 68% reported improved focus, the gains were most pronounced when paired with structured routines and teacher training. The device amplifies, but doesn’t replace, the human element—something too often overlooked in tech-driven reforms.

From Tools to Trauma-Informed Design

Modern adaptive equipment increasingly embraces trauma-informed principles. Think adjustable-height desks that accommodate sensory needs without stigmatization, or noise-canceling headphones that reduce auditory overload in crowded classrooms. These aren’t just comfort features—they’re interventions. For a student with ADHD or sensory processing disorder, an environment that respects neural differences fosters psychological safety, a known catalyst for engagement and retention.

Take the case of “smart pens” embedded with AI that transcribe speech in real time and map thought patterns. Used in pilot programs across Germany and Singapore, these devices don’t just capture content—they decode cognitive effort, offering teachers real-time feedback on comprehension lags. Yet, as promising as they are, they raise ethical questions: Who owns the data? How do we prevent surveillance overreach? The technology advances, but trust must precede deployment.

The Path Forward: Integration, Not Isolation

The future lies in holistic ecosystems. In Finland’s progressive schools, adaptive equipment is embedded in universal design for learning (UDL) frameworks—where every classroom anticipates diverse needs by default. Students don’t “need” special tools; the environment is built to serve them. This model reduces stigma, streamlines access, and improves outcomes across the board. It’s not about segregation—it’s about inclusion reimagined.

As researchers at Stanford’s Center for Disability Research emphasize, adaptive equipment works best when viewed not as a temporary fix, but as a dynamic partner in lifelong learning. For a student with dyscalculia, a tablet app that visualizes math through spatial puzzles isn’t a crutch—it’s a scaffold that builds confidence, one interaction at a time.
